SUMMARY:
Velocity is in search of a Safety Advisor to oversee the client’s project safety program, regulatory compliance in the field, injury prevention, risk assessment, communications, and safety training.
This is a 6 month assignment working with a full-service interiors contractor in Michigan City, Indiana. (Local candidates, no per diem)
JOB FUNCTIONS:
· Work with the Project Management team to plan, implement and supervise the project environmental, health and, safety requirements.
· Address and recommend corrective action for violations, incidents, and trends.
· Reinforces safety culture with field team members, promoting positive reinforcement through coaching and mentoring.
· Complete daily field Safety audits utilizing the electronic safety software provided.
· Assists with follow up on any OSHA related issues, citations, and/or documentation requirements.
· Attend project related safety and pre-construction meetings.
· Assist with injury, general liability and near miss investigations.
· Provide and oversee Safety Orientation processes.
· Assists in development of written site safety plans and JHA’s for hazardous activities.
· Responsible for creation and delivery of relevant weekly safety talks.
· Periodically present information for Safety Stand Downs and pre-shift huddles.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
· Minimum of 5-10 years of Construction experience, specific to Marine Safety, Pile Driving and Sheet Piling.
· OSHA 510
· OSHA 30 Hour Certification
· First Aid/CPR/AED Certification
· Microsoft Office skills required
· Ability to positively interact and influence field team members to create a safe and healthy work environment.
